{"product_id":"9780826479709","title":"The Reception of Isaac Newton in Europe","description":"\u003cp\u003eThe writings and example of Isaac Newton transformed understandings of the practice and meaning of the sciences across Europe in the century or so following the publication of the \u003ci\u003ePrincipia\u003c\/i\u003e in 1687. The essays in these volumes consider the impact of Newton's ideas from three distinct but interlocking perspectives: their reception in particular geographical areas and language communities; their importance for particular fields of intellectual and practical endeavour, and their influence on other thinkers who, in turban, shaped Newton's intellectual legacy. They provide, for the first time, a picture of the fate of Newton's work across mainland Europe, giving an account of Newton's influence in the arts and social sciences, as well as in mathematics or physics.\u003c\/p\u003e","brand":"Bloomsbury Academic","offers":[{"title":"Default Title","offer_id":47021425754352,"sku":"9780826479709","price":406.0,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":false}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0737\/7593\/9824\/files\/9780826479709_p0.jpg?v=1763754344","url":"https:\/\/shop-qa.barnesandnoble.com\/products\/9780826479709","provider":"Barnes \u0026 Noble (DEV)","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
